on Senin, 13 Februari 2017
Tutorial : Cara Membuat Splash Screen

Haloo…teman-teman kembali lagi di Blog saya kali ini saya mau menunjukkan tutorial cara Membuat Splash screen

Splash screen adalah intro aplikasi kita, dimana setiap kita membuka aplikasi terdapat sebuah intro yang biasanya berisi logo aplikasi, nama aplikasi dan sedikit review tentang aplikasi tersebut

Nah..mari kita langsung mulai membuat nya…



1). Pertama buat lah project Baru dengan nama Splash Screen

Lalu klik next…


2).Pilih SDK nya di rekomendasikan Ice Cream Sandwich kalo saya menggunakan Jelly Bean karena rata-rata smartphone os nya jelly bean J


    Klik next lagi…

3). Lalu pilih activity nya empty Activity


   
   Klik next…lagi

4). Setelah selesai Buat lah sebuah activity baru dengan nama SplashActivity




5). Jika sudah ,Masuk ke activity_splash lalu anda edit sesuka hati kalian 

<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out
xmlns:android="http://schemas.android.com/apk/res/android"
   
xmlns:tools="http://schemas.android.com/tools"
   
android:id="@+id/activity_splash"
   
android:layout_width="match_parent"
   
android:layout_height="match_parent"
   
android:paddingBottom="@dimen/activity_vertical_margin"
   
android:paddingLeft="@dimen/activity_horizontal_margin"
   
android:paddingRight="@dimen/activity_horizontal_margin"
   
android:paddingTop="@dimen/activity_vertical_margin"
   
tools:context="com.ammarnavi.intraculture.SplashActivity"
   
android:background="#40b0b4">

    <ImageView
       
android:layout_width="410dp"
       
android:layout_height="500dp"
       
android:src="@drawable/culturevector"
       
android:id="@+id/imageView"
       
android:layout_above="@+id/textView"
       
android:layout_centerHorizontal="true"
       
android:layout_marginBottom="10dp" />

    <TextView
       
android:layout_width="wrap_content"
       
android:layout_height="wrap_content"
       
android:text="INTRA CULTURE"
       
android:textSize="45dp"
       
android:textAlignment="center"
       
android:fontFamily="cursive"
       
android:id="@+id/textView"
       
android:layout_marginBottom="144dp"
       
android:layout_alignParentBottom="true"
       
android:layout_centerHorizontal="true" />

</RelativeLayout>


Disini Splash screen saya hasilnya seperti ini






















Ini adalah aplikasi Intra Culture punya saya hehe…

6).jika sudah mendesain dan lain lain masuk ke Splash activity dan ketikkan seperti ini


public class SplashActivity extends AppCompatActivity {



    @Override

    protected void onCreate(Bundle savedInstanceState) {

        super.onCreate(savedInstanceState);

        setContentView(R.layout.activity_splash);

        Handler handler=new Handler();

        handler.postDelayed(new Runnable() {

            @Override

            public void run() {

                Intent a = new Intent(getApplicationContext(),MainActivity.class);

                startActivity(a);

                finish();

            }

        },3000);

    }

}

disini saya menggunakan intent agar setelah splash maka akan menuju ke MainActivity

7). setelah itu run aplikasi nya dan lihat Hasil nya






Sekian Dari saya…semoga Bermanfaat

0 komentar:

Posting Komentar